Book design is the art and science of incorporating content, style, format, design, and sequence into a cohesive whole that is a book. It's about shaping the reader's experience, guiding them through the text and images in a way that is both engaging and effortless. While the cover is often the first thing that draws a reader in, book design encompasses every aspect of the book, from the choice of typeface and the layout of the pages to the selection of paper and binding materials. It's a field that blends artistic sensibility with technical precision, requiring a deep understanding of how visual elements can enhance or detract from the reading experience.
